Manchester City hosts Aston Villa in the 31st round of the Premier League at the Etihad Stadium, a high-stakes duel as the third against the fourth of the table, accumulating between them only one defeat in the last five games.
Guardiola's side are still without Ederson in goal, Kyle Walker at full-back due to a thigh problem and Nathan Ake, who had to be substituted in the previous match against Mikel Arteta's Arsenal.
The Villains, meanwhile, have more injuries for this game as Unai Emery will be without Ollie Watkins, Tyrone Mings, Boubacar Kamara, Emiliano Buendia, Matty Cash, Jacob Ramsey, and John McGinn, who is suspended.
Confirmed lineups for the clash
Manchester City starting lineup: Ortega (GK); Lewis, Dias, Akanji, Gvardiol; Rodri, Silva; Doku, Foden, Grealish; Alvarez.
Aston Villa starting lineup: Martinez (GK); Konsa, Carlos, Lenglet, Digne; Iroegbunam, Luiz, Zaniolo, Rogers; Diaby, Duran.
